With county team activity now ceased the main energy of the Kingspan Century sponsored Supporters Club will now be directed towards domestic matters with the draws for the All Ireland senior hurling and senior football championship final tickets taking priority. The cards for the draw for the senior hurling championship final tickets have already been distributed around the county, to clubs and through various other retail outlets, and the Supporters Club is hoping for at least as good a response as they got last year. To be in with a chance of winning two tickets for the All Ireland senior hurling championship final costs ?2 per line. The draw will be held in John Joe Cunninghams in Carrickmacross on the Friday night prior to the All Ireland senior hurling championship final, i.e. Friday, September 5th. Following that draw the cards for the draw for the tickets for the All Ireland senior football championship final will be distributed with that draw taking place on Friday, September 19th.
